Paper Illusions: The Art of Isabelle de Borchgrave

Belgian artist, designer, and interior decorator Isabelle de Borchgrave has created exquisite paper dresses evoking high fashions from the courts of the Medici in the Renaissance to the legendary Fortuny silks of the early 20th century. Their historical authenticity, combined with their startling realism, caused an overnight sensation when they were first shown in France in 1998 as "papiers à la mode." Since then, the dynamic, light-hearted collection has traveled all over the world to critical and popular acclaim.
